$25 per private vehicle.
You can also purchase an annual pass for all National Parks and other federal recreation lands for $80.
Senior citizens 62 and over, who are US citizens or permanent residents of the US, may purchase a lifetime Senior Pass for $10 that covers the admission fees for all federal properties.

a ticket that gives you access to the Skywalk is currently $29.95 per person

It should be noted that a Legacy Pass ($43/person) is required additional to the Skywalk ticket in order to gain entrance into the park. Bringing the total to $73/person.

All personal belongings including CAMERAS are NOT ALLOWED on Skywalk. Photos can only be taken with parks cameras for a fee.

Items can be stored in lockers for $3 Drivers should know that the unfinished dirt/gravel road leading into park can be quite taxing on vehicles.

How does Hells Canyon and the Grand Canyon compare?

Both are exceptional places to visit but the Grand Canyon takes the Blue Ribbon in this competition. Depending on how and where it is measured, the Snake River has carved Hells Canyon deeper by 2,000 feet, but at 10 miles in length, it is dwarfed by the 277 miles of the Grand Canyon carved by the Colorado River. The Grand Canyon is easily accessible, has a much greater variety and length of trails and better amenities.
